SUMMARY:

This position is responsible for maintaining a clean and safe working environment for all staff and visitors at SCHC facilities.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Clean, disinfect, and sanitize exam rooms, restrooms, offices, and common areas in accordance with established cleaning schedules, infection prevention protocols, and organizational policies to support patient safety and continuity of care.
  • Perform routine floor care, including sweeping, mopping, washing, buffing, vacuuming, and carpet cleaning, to maintain a safe, clean, and accessible environment across all clinic locations.
  • Properly collect, remove, and dispose of trash, recycling, and shredding materials in accordance with clinic procedures and safety standards.
  • Clean and maintain furniture, fixtures, windows, screens, and light fixtures; replace light bulbs as needed to ensure a well-maintained and functional facility.
  • Assist Facilities Maintenance staff with exterior upkeep, including sweeping debris, washing walkways, and supporting basic landscaping activities to maintain safe and accessible entrances, walkways, and grounds.
  • Maintain janitorial equipment, tools, and storage areas in a clean, organized, and safe manner to reduce hazards and support efficient operations.
  • Monitor janitorial supply inventory, ensure awareness of Safety Data Sheet (SDS) locations, and promptly report supply needs or new chemical products to the Facilities Maintenance Manager to support OSHA compliance.
  • Follow all OSHA safety requirements, including proper chemical handling, labeling, use of personal protective equipment (PPE), and reporting of safety concerns or hazards.
  • Maintain HIPAA compliance by safeguarding patient privacy and confidentiality while performing duties in clinical and administrative areas, limiting access to protected health information to the minimum necessary.
  • Keep delivery, storage, and service areas clear of boxes, supplies, and obstructions to ensure safe access, emergency egress, and efficient clinic operations.
  • Perform routine cleaning of breakroom and kitchen areas, including loading and emptying dishwashers as assigned.
  • Accurately record attendance and hours worked in accordance with organizational timekeeping and HR policies.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ned to support clinic operations and compliance requirements.
